In-Depth Review TG4G Review ·2026-06-08 · For reference only

What It Is

Incorporate.ph is a company incorporation and asset preservation service website aimed at the Philippine market. The core services listed on the page include Company Incorporation, Corporate Tax Filing, and Secretarial Services. Its pitch is to help clients complete company registration, set up reporting, and assist with opening a bank account online, emphasizing that there is “no need to go anywhere.” The site references Asset Preservation Services behind the offering and discloses an office address in Makati, Philippines.

Core Services and Jurisdiction

Based on the main content, the service primarily covers the Philippine jurisdiction. It explicitly states that it helps ensure companies comply with Philippine regulatory requirements and annual compliance obligations. The scope is not limited to one-time incorporation; it also extends to tax filing, secretarial services, corporate compliance, and accounting support. Its asset preservation narrative is relatively prominent, highlighting the use of a company to hold assets, bank accounts, and investments, facilitate asset transfers, and provide a degree of liability separation through the company’s separate legal personality.

Pricing and Process

The website presents a three-step process: fill out the application form, submit the required documents, and protect your assets. It also provides an “Apply Now” entry point. However, it does not disclose specific pricing, government fees, service fees, bank account opening costs, or whether there are different packages. Processing times and the required document list are also not explained. Users therefore still need to contact the provider before making a decision to confirm the total cost, service boundaries, and timeline.

Pros and Cons

The advantages are that the service chain is relatively complete, covering post-incorporation tax, secretarial, and annual compliance needs. It also provides a physical address and claims to have more than 8 years of experience in corporate compliance and accounting, as well as having served a large number of companies. The drawbacks are also clear: the page contains several pieces of text that appear to be template placeholders, such as sentences related to logos and website design, which do not match the company incorporation theme and weaken its professional credibility. Key information is also not transparent enough, especially pricing, processing time, payment methods, registered agent or virtual address arrangements.

Who It’s For and Access from China

This service is better suited to individuals, families, and business owners who want to establish a company in the Philippines, maintain local compliance, or arrange asset preservation through a corporate structure. The main content does not provide information on access from China, and payment methods are not disclosed. Chinese users are advised to first use the contact form to confirm whether remote clients from China are accepted, what payment methods are available, what KYC documents are required, and whether Chinese-language support is offered. If transparent pricing is important, it is also worth comparing local Philippine law firms, accounting firms, or international company incorporation platforms.
